The Android LG GW620 is Looking Good

LG GW620LG is really bringing out the big guns this year with its new line of smart phones. The mobile industry has been enjoying the recent releases from major manufacturers such as Sony Ericsson, T-Mobile, Samsung and others. It makes sense that LG has been a busy bee as well. Their latest offering is a series of smart phones that targets different markets in order to penetrate the smart phone crowd. For the hard core android users, they have created the GW620. This android smart phone has been lurking quietly in the shadows while LG’s other Windows Mobile based devices have been stealing the spotlight. But as the day of its release date grows closer, the GW620 is gathering some serious steam.

Promising Looks

This mobile phone looks good, really good. The slide out keyboard, dark gray matte finish, even the layout of the face buttons and nub all add to the charm and beauty of this device. When closed, the GW620 is serious little machine accentuated with soft rounded edges. The almost black color gives it a hint of sophistication and refinement in style. Sliding out the full QWERTY keypad on the side, you get to appreciate the wide button layout and the slight bluish hue. Externally, this mobile phone is a real beauty. The jacks and buttons on the edges are all located strategically allowing you to easily grasp and use this mobile phone with one hand.

Initial Specifications

Despite being a new model, there are already a lot of expectations from the LG GW620. This is, after all, an Android phone; and the Android is an excellent operating system that should not be wasted on just any phone. For now, LG is promising users with the standard range of specs. A-GPS support is present, so expect some navigation apps available. Media playback is also a given, time will tell what file types are supported. It has WiFi, GPRS, HSDPA, and EDGE connectivity, quad band support and of course, expandable memory.
